Oats can also taste Fantastico....!!!

7:42 PM | Publish by Apurva



Nowadays lot of people are talking about oats. It’s quite becoming a fashion to include oats in many food preparations. Oats have very high nutritive value as they are rich in fibre and other minerals. So let us looks at some interesting recipes that we can make with oats.

Oats Porridge
Well this is the most common recipe prepared with oats. Here be boil the oats with milk and sugar till it gets a creamy texture. You can add some nuts and fruits to enhance its taste and nutritive value.

Oats Upma
This one is my favorite recipe. To make oats upma, dry roast the oats till they become light golden brown. Then in a pan, heat some oil and add the curry leaves and rai. Put some onions and fry till translucent. You can add more vegetables like carrots, peas, beans etc and let them cook from sometime. Add the roasted oats to this along with hot water and salt and let it cook till the water is absorbed. Garnish with some fresh coriander leaves.

Oats Idli
This is a very simple and nutritive recipe and a good substitute to the traditional idlis. For this you have to coarsely ground the oats and then mix it with sour curd to make a batter. To this batter give a tadka of curry leaves and rai, chana dal, cashewnuts etc. Now you can make the fantastico idlis with this batter.

Oats Kheer
Can you imagine if the kheer can be tasty and healthy too? Yes we can make kheer with oats too. You have to just roast the oats till golden brown. Now in a vessel heat the milk and bring it to boil. Now add the oats and let the milk boil in slow flame till it thickens. Then add the sugar and nuts to the kheer and mix well. To make the kheer healthier you can replace the sugar with honey or jaggery.

Oats Tikki
This tikki is very simple. Just take some boiled potatoes, green peas, chopped carrots and onions and mash them. Now to this mixture add around one cup of oats along with the required seasoning as per taste and mix well. Make a tikki shape with this mixture. To make the outer crust crispier you can dip this tikki in milk and then coat it with some grounded oats. Now you can shallow fry this tikkis. These fantastico tikkis can replace your aloo tikki chaat or the burger tikki.
